This paper proposes a modular architecture for the development of an indoor testbed for intelligent transportation systems. The main focus is on repeatable, low-cost tests for urban scenarios, especially for higher-level decision making and situation awareness problems. It provides a supplement to outdoor tests and it is also used as a teaching platform. The proposed architecture has been in use at the Ohio State University Control and Intelligent Transportation Research Laboratory, as demonstrated in a number of traffic scenarios.
